Dubai property purchases require substantial upfront capital that must clear your account by specific dates, not approximate months. The coordination demands precision that traditional sale methods simply cannot provide.
| Expense Category | Amount Required | Timing |
|---|---|---|
| Property deposit (minimum) | 25% of purchase price | Before reservation |
| Dubai Land Department fee | 4% of property value | At registration |
| Estate agent commission | 2% plus VAT | At completion |
| Security deposit (rental) | 5% to 10% of annual rent | Before move in |
| DEWA connection | AED 2,000 to 4,000 | Upon arrival |
| Visa processing | AED 3,000 to 5,000 per person | Within first month |
| International removals | £3,000 to £8,000 | Coordinated with completion |
These figures represent genuine commitments that Dubai landlords, developers, and government departments expect on confirmed dates. Vague estate agent timelines or failed auction attempts leave you scrambling to rearrange international commitments or worse, losing Dubai opportunities entirely.

Auctioning a property appears to offer speed and certainty through a fixed sale date. Property auctioneers market impressive success rates, often claiming 75% to 80% of properties sell. These figures deserve scrutiny before you stake your international relocation on an auction result.
Auctioneers inflate their reported success rates by including properties sold before the auction event through pre-auction negotiations and those sold after the auction to interested bidders who failed to commit on the day. Whilst a sale remains a sale, this practice obscures the true rate of properties that actually sell under the hammer on their first attempt. Furthermore, these statistics rarely account for properties that fail to sell and simply appear in the following month’s catalogue, masking genuine first attempt failure rates.
The financial risks compound the uncertainty. Auction entry fees range from £500 to £1,500 regardless of whether your property sells. Legal pack preparation adds another £500 to £1,000. Reserve prices set too high mean no sale, whilst reserves set too low can mean accepting significantly less than market value when you desperately need every pound for your Dubai deposit.

The we buy any house sector contains genuine companies and unscrupulous operators who’ve perfected the art of deception. These liar cash buyers target time pressured sellers relocating abroad, knowing desperation makes you vulnerable to their tactics.
Their signature strategy involves staged valuations designed to hook you before systematically reducing their offer. They send two separate valuers to your property within days of each other. The first provides an encouraging valuation that matches their initial offer, building your confidence and securing your commitment. The second valuer arrives later with a clipboard and a mission to manufacture faults. Outdated electrics, minor cosmetic issues, and questionable damp readings all get documented to justify the inevitable offer reduction that arrives weeks later.
The “last minute discovery” represents their most cynical tactic. Just before exchange, they claim their surveyor has uncovered serious problems: subsidence risks, structural concerns, or planning permission issues. With your Dubai start date looming, your international removals booked, and no other buyers lined up, they know you’ll likely accept a substantially reduced offer rather than collapse the entire relocation plan.
Reputable cash home buyers operate with clean balance sheets and transparent structures. Liar operators reveal themselves through their Companies House filings, which anyone can access for £1 per company report.

Search the company name on the Companies House website and examine their filing history. Multiple charges registered against the company indicate heavy borrowing, which explains why they cannot actually complete purchases quickly despite their promises. Companies with dozens of charges often use investor funding that requires lengthy approval processes, contradicting their “cash buyer” claims.
Check the director history as well. Directors operating multiple dissolved companies or those with disqualification orders should trigger immediate concern. Liar cash buyers frequently close one company after accumulating complaints and simply open another with a slightly different name, leaving a trail of dissolved entities across their director profiles.
